I think this is very close to what is going on here. Faye may feel uncertain as to whether her current feelings are 'simple' jealousy when finding out your partner may have had other/more prior partners than you thought, or whether her current feelings are an indication that she may have only been open to the relationship with Bubbles because of its fairytale aspects of 'first one for each other' and 'meant to be' uniqueness. The sudden realization that your current relationship is possibly 'just' a next one in a line for your partner instead of her deliberately having chosen you as 'the one' can be unsettling, if hopefully only briefly.

It's worth considering whether Faye has ever really thought about her current relationship and future and how it relates to her and Bubbles' own histories in more detail, and this may be the trigger to do so.

FWIW, I think she will come to realize that her love for Bubbles and their relationship is entirely sincere and exactly what she wants.
